Transaction 98664478a63b495f59ea099599b8154dec5b80770b0369b8899b9ba4d27a4454
1 Input
1 Output
-
98664478a63b495f59ea099599b8154dec5b80770b0369b8899b9ba4d27a4454:0
- value
- 1540275
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d638808684e538f30e431e5a581effc79dc3563 OP_EQUAL
- address
- 3Qnp7dyL9eCoBaudJJbi4RV9arooYRXhwy